1. Is Lucky Hunter Casino legal for Australian players?
Online gambling laws in Australia are complex. The Interactive Gambling Act of 2001 prohibits unlicensed operators from offering real-money games to Australians. Lucky Hunter appears to operate under an offshore license, which means it may not be regulated by Australian authorities. Players should verify their local laws and gamble responsibly.

3. How long do withdrawals take?
Processing times vary by method. E-wallets are usually the fastest (24–48 hours), while bank transfers and card withdrawals can take 3–5 business days. The casino may also have a pending period before releasing funds.
